School: Smithills School

Working pattern: 33 hrs per week Term Time Only Plus 5 Days

Contract type: Permanent Position

Salary: Grade E pt 11-17 £28,142 - £31,022 pro rata (Actual Salary at pt 11 £21,500)

Closing date: Tuesday 19th May 2026 at 9.00am

Interview date: w/c 1st June 2026

The Role

We are looking to appoint an enthusiastic and well qualified candidate to work with the SENCO and teaching staff to develop best practice for SEN children. You will work with and supervise individuals and groups of children under the direction/instruction of teaching & or senior staff, inclusive of specific individual learning needs, enabling access to learning for all pupils. You will assess the needs of pupils through individually tailored key performance indicators and ensure practices are in place so pupils with SEND in mainstream classes make progress.

About You

You will have the ability to work effectively within a team environment, understanding classroom roles and responsibilities, and the ability to build effective working relationships with all pupils and colleagues. You will demonstrate an informed and efficient approach to teaching and learning by adopting relevant strategies to support the work of the teacher and increase achievement of those with SEND.

How to prepare for a job interview at Bolton Gin Company

Know Your SEN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s (SEN) and the specific strategies that can help these students thrive. Familiarise yourself with the key performance indicators mentioned in the job description, as this will show your understanding of how to assess and support individual learning needs.

Show Your Team Spirit

Since you'll be working closely with the SENCO and teaching staff, it's crucial to demonstrate your ability to collaborate effectively. Think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ully worked in a team, and be ready to share how you can contribute to a positive classroom environment.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ect to be asked about specific scenarios involving SEND students. Prepare by thinking through how you would handle various situations, such as supporting a child who is struggling to engage or managing behaviour in a group setting. This will showcase your problem-solving skills and your proactive approach.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the school's approach to inclusivity or how they measure the progress of SEND students. This not only shows your interest in the role but also gives you valuable insights into the school's culture and expectations.
